Output 8098fd038d73f97c0b116232c95aaac68eeb3788ac2f88e26e650babd5faf511:23

value
43799023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f90b70bb1686f0db827b2eb5b26d90521d17a6d OP_EQUAL
address
MKXfQmY3sjwL7rLtuMGR8QcpB5umCsK7g7
transaction
8098fd038d73f97c0b116232c95aaac68eeb3788ac2f88e26e650babd5faf511
spent
true